Summer 2019, Berlin/Frankfurt, Germany
>> By speaking to 350+ owners of convenience stores in Berlin and Frankfurt, before the actual launch of a product, we found out that these owners, of which 95% have Turkish roots, don’t discuss their business with German sales people. Our client could have been rejected in every sales call, simply thinking the product isn’t a fit. Based on these learnings we organised a team on the ground fit to match the culture.<<<
With our actionable research approach, we got to the shelf of 100 stores in both cities within just 4 weeks after launch.
